Use Case: Quantum Computing

Radiocomm offers three types of cable assemblies that can be used for each of the temperature ‘tier’ requirements found in a quantum computer system. Niobium-titanium (Niob-Titan) alloy cable assemblies can support the ‘ultra-harsh’ cold environments while the Aluminum alloy assemblies are only suitable for the ‘warmest’ of the three temperature tiers:

Product OptionsChoose between three cryogenic cable product categories based on your specific application requirements.
Rigid Aluminium Alloy Tube CableLightweight with good air tightness. Maintains excellent mechanical performance at low temp.
Rigid Cupronickel Alloy Tube CableSlightly higher performance properties compared to Rigid Aluminium Alloy. No low temperature brittleness.
Rigid Niob-Titan Alloy Tube CableMaintains excellent mechanical properties at ultra-low temperature. Superconducting properties.
